EU investigation delays Liberty Media's MotoGP acquisition
The European Union has launched an investigation into Liberty Media's acquisition of MotoGP, prompting delays before a confirmed takeover. Liberty Media revealed earlier this year that it had agreed to purchase an 86% majority ownership of Dorna Sports, which holds the rights to the MotoGP and WorldSBK championships.
